uint32_t EcUtil::FieldSizeInBytes(EllipticCurveType curve_type) {
  auto ec_group_result = SubtleUtilBoringSSL::GetEcGroup(curve_type);
  if (!ec_group_result.ok()) return 0;
  bssl::UniquePtr<EC_GROUP> ec_group(ec_group_result.ValueOrDie());
  return (EC_GROUP_get_degree(ec_group.get()) + 7) / 8;
}

// static
crypto::tink::util::StatusOr<uint32_t> EcUtil::EncodingSizeInBytes(
    EllipticCurveType curve_type, EcPointFormat point_format) {
  int coordinate_size = FieldSizeInBytes(curve_type);
  if (coordinate_size == 0) {
    return ToStatusF(crypto::tink::util::error::INVALID_ARGUMENT,
                     "Unsupported elliptic curve type: %s",
                     EnumToString(curve_type).c_str());
  }
  switch (point_format) {
  case EcPointFormat::UNCOMPRESSED:
    return 2 * coordinate_size + 1;
  case EcPointFormat::DO_NOT_USE_CRUNCHY_UNCOMPRESSED:
    return 2 * coordinate_size;
  case EcPointFormat::COMPRESSED:
    return coordinate_size + 1;
  default:
    return ToStatusF(crypto::tink::util::error::INVALID_ARGUMENT,
                     "Unsupported elliptic curve point format: %s",
                     EnumToString(point_format).c_str());
